In Short

  • Develop and oversee benefits, enhancing the employee experience.
  • Manage operations of self-insured health plans and 401(k) plan.
  • Administer the annual open enrollment cycle.
  • Partner with benefits broker for trends and plan utilization.
  • Manage leave of absence programs ensuring compliance.
  • Complete compliance-related tasks and audits.
  • Develop employee communications regarding benefits.
  • Provide guidance on benefits administration.
  • Partner with internal teams on employee issues.
  • Ensure benefits documentation is up to date.

Requirements

  • 5+ years in Benefits & Leave Administration roles.
  • Experience with Workday benefits module preferred.
  • Strong understanding of FMLA and disability programs.
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ience.
  • Certified Benefits Professional is a plus.
  • Intermediate proficiency in Excel.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Detail-oriented and organized.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
  • Customer service orientation with confidentiality.
